Re: Headlight and brake light not working

Post by MikeB »

Jenneverett1 wrote: Tue May 05, 2020 10:08 am On my GL1500 I am also having no headlight and no foot brake light... the hand brake activates the brake light fine.
I checked the fuse for the headlight in the fuse box, but it was fine. I am looking for a solution.
A stuck, dirty or otherwise malfunctioning start switch can keep the headlight from working. Try flipping/snapping the start switch a few times.

The brake light may be due to the foot brake switch. Remove the right side engine cover above the right foot rest and see if you can locate the brake switch. It should be easy to find. Operate the brake lever and see if the switch is operating. You will see the spring that is attached to the switch moving as you press the lever down.

Re: Headlight and brake light not working

Post by MikeB »

Jenneverett1 wrote: Tue May 05, 2020 10:08 am On my GL1500 I am also having no headlight and no foot brake light... the hand brake activates the brake light fine.
I checked the fuse for the headlight in the fuse box, but it was fine. I am looking for a solution.
There are two separate headlight relays that operate the Hi Beams and the Low Beams.
Relay #8 is for the Low Beams and Relay #4 is for the Hi Beams.

Do either the Hi Or Lo Beams not work or do both of them not work?

Fuse #5 is the headlight fuse.

Re: Headlight and brake light not working

Post by MikeB »

Also, take a look at Fuse #12. Remove it and test it. It is the power feed for the Headlight Relays. If that fuse is open, there will be no headlights

Re: Headlight and brake light not working

Post by MikeB »

Does the blue HI BEAM indicator work when you switch to HI BEAM?
The voltage to the indicator is fed from the same source as the HI BEAM. If it works, then you can be sure that the voltage for the HI BEAM bulbs is present.

At this point, I would remove the headlight assembly and troubleshoot that. Everything else seems to be okay.
